Abstract :
Airline fleet composition, which means determining the airplane types and the numbers of each type needed by an airline, is important in affecting its operational performance. Through analyzing the disadvantage of traditional method of evaluating fleet composition, which is difficult to evaluate the revenue and operating cost, we put forward a new method to evaluate the feet composition by integrating the fleet composition and fleet assignment. Under an expected airline operational environment, getting the information of flight schedule, expected reservation demand and mean price of each flight from simulating airline flight assignment, we simulate the airline operation with different fleet composition scenarios, and then evaluate the fleet composition by calculating the corresponding planned direct cost (POC). The optimal scenario is the one with the lowest POC. Numerical experiment shows that this idea is effective.
